A termite inspection of an average-sized home can cost you around $250 to $350, depending on the size, style and ease of access.

It is recommended you have a comprehensive pest inspection at least once a year, or even more often in the event that you reside in areas having higher termite risk.

The susceptibility of the property to termite infestation (subfloor ventilation and drainage, evident damp areas, etc..)

The Australian standards require a pest inspector to have a certain amount of technical knowledge and experience. They should know about local building practices as well as the habits of termites, in which they're very likely to be found and also the signs of infestation. To gain that level of competency, a wood pest inspector should have:.

Achieved competence in units 8 and 10 (that deal especially with inspecting, reporting and controlling timber pests) of the National Pest Management Competency Standards (or equivalent experience).

The Australian Environmental Pest Managers Association (AEPMA) is the significant industry association. It sets standards for the pest management industry, represents pest managers and administers PestCert so you know a pest management company meets the greatest possible accreditation standards.

Look for professional indemnity and public liability insurance when getting quotations and ask to see certificates of currency.

Professional indemnity learn the facts here now protects the pest manager against negligence claims arising out of inspections, quotations and treatments performed.

Public liability insurance protects against injuries and property damage caused as a result of the work completed.

Ask about the warranty supplied for the work and see the fine print. Long warranty periods may ask that you cover annual check-ups to keep a 10-year warranty valid, in which case it is hardly a real 10-year warranty.

One of the most confusing things about termites is they look like ants. Its amazing how termites look like ants since they even have wings at certain times in their lives, similar to flying ants do.

However, their appearances are similar. You need to have the ability to tell the difference between the two so that you know which type of infestation you have.

There are two types of termites that exist: winged and wingless. Both these pests look just like their ant counterparts, however there are ways a person with a trained eye will have the ability to correctly identify both advice of these pests.

Winged termites are known as termite swarms. The term swarm comes in the termites capacity to fly in swarms and scout out new regions for a colony. These termites will swarm at different seasons, depending on the type of species. But one thing always stays the same: termites only swarm in warm weather. .
